depends on what you r gonna do with it
I started with a rough country 2.5 BB because I traded my tires and wheels in on some 35s and I had to make the trade under a certain milage. I didnt have the cash to buy lift i wanted in the end. But I really didnt have many issues with the ride whil running the BB(street only) but i was definetly going to need some adjustable trac bars and probably control arms if i would have kept that setup. I only drive my JK on off days (14 days a month) but I make wheeling trips as often as I can. So my advise is to run the BB if you are not going to do alot of wheeling but start saving for a few more parts down the road. When I started to add the cost of the parts I would eventually need, It was better for me to buy a complete lift. I opted for the Full traction Ultimate 3" and it is sweet. as far as drive shafts are concerned I only repaced the rear for now and it was not really expensive and easy to swap out. Ill replace the front eventually. I have a 2dr so I needed the rear asap. hope this helps you out.
